你查询的IP:[203.89.106.36]  地理位置:澳大利亚

最新查询58.30.70.44 58.30.72.120 202.92.80.16 120.64.88.112 122.192.4.219 121.239.16.17 58.16.196.195 119.19.58.210 119.19.171.172 203.89.106.36 125.62.55.38 123.128.18.83 203.93.183.42 210.56.192.134 58.14.113.180 114.80.5.76 202.127.40.12 203.171.224.185 124.160.247.51 119.44.194.184 202.164.119.124 116.255.128.4 202.127.212.78 123.199.128.197 202.38.192.65 124.14.203.36 58.99.128.204 192.124.154.183 210.72.155.4 166.111.167.214 119.63.32.44